Review Topic: K3 Visa

yeehaw!!!! Personal questions were asked about my marriage like when, where and who. I was asked to look at my marriage pictures and show the consolate that evidence showing a marriage relationship. Remember that when you go to the embassy they randomly call the numbers. Being at the embassy early doesnt matter because you get a random number inside. So if your appointment is at 7:00 show up at 7. Not first come first serve. How long have you been married? What does your husband do for work? How old is your husband? Can your husband support you? Please show your husbands w-2 and employment information? Apparently age was not a factor. 5 minutes for prescreening(submit all required documents) and 3 minutes for consolute interview. Then go to delbros window 35 to pay fees for delivery. Then go home (the time is spent by waiting in line and number)

Review Topic: K1 Visa

The interview went well. Leondesa was asked how did we meet?; if I had been married; if I had children. I was asked if I was the petitioner. I was asked when We will get married; I said when she gets to the US. The consulate flipped through the Yahoo messages. I was kind and did not submit all three inches of the stack. She flipped through the emails. She said you certainly have coorespondence. Go to the next window for delivery instructions. Then we went off to the Delbros window.

Review Topic: K1 Visa

Worried about the interview for months naturally 6 minutes flat green sticker said approved. She attended the interview alone. Aff of support most important document. Easy interview. Delbros delivered the visa in 6 days total to a Manila address.
